IMPORTANT INFORMATION ON AUTOMATED TRASH COLLECTION
Additional Carts & Barcoding
Hudson Residents will receive one cart free as part of the new automated collection program. A second cart may be purchased if necessary. We would encourage residents to remove all the recyclable items out of your regular trash, before purchasing a second container. This will reduce the volume in your trash disposal dramatically. The recyclables you remove save the Town of Hudson a substantial amount of money. If you feel you need a second cart, the one time cost to the resident is $75.00. Credit card or check are acceptable forms of payment. Checks must be made out to Pinard Waste Systems. note: All carts are bar-coded to the residential address to which the cart is placed. When purchasing a second collection cart you will notice that it is a different color than the free cart provided by the Town of Hudson. This cart is also bar coded to the residents in which it is delivered. No residential address may have two free cart colors. If this happens the cart will be scanned and return to the correct address. Missing or damaged Carts If for some reason the cart is destroyed, a new cart will be provided free of charge upon the return of the damaged cart. Missing carts will be replaced upon notification to Pinard Waste Systems. Damaged carts will be repaired at no cost to the resident. Call Pinard Waste Systems at 1-800-675-7933. Please detail the nature of the needed repair. (Lid, wheel, etc.)

Guidelines for Automated trash Collection
On July 1, 2007, the Town of Hudson, NH will start automated curbside collection for trash. Residents that receive a wheeled container should follow the simple guidelines specifically designed for automated collection. Please read this resident user guide completely. It contains important program information • All trash should be in a plastic bag and then placed in the automated collection cart issued by the Town of Hudson. • Trash left beside the cart or in other containers will not be collected. • Collection cart lids should be closed. • Collection carts must be set in an accessible location: At least 5 feet from any obstruction such as trees, telephone poles, cars and mailboxes, within 2 feet of the curb and away from low hanging utilities. • Carts that are inaccessible will not be serviced until the following week. • The cart must be placed so that the handle faces the curb. • All carts must be at the curb by 7:00 AM on your trash day. • No hazardous or building materials, yard waste, brush, recyclables or corrugated cardboard should be placed in your cart. • Recycling bins and barrels should be placed on the curb as to not interfere with the automated collection process. RESIDENTIAL PICK-UP OF BULKY AND WHITE GOODS
Hudson residents may call Pinard Waste Systems at 1-800-675-7933 to schedule a curbside pick-up of any bulky item or White Goods item needing disposal. This service will be provided once per month. user fees for this service is as follows: • $30.00 for all Freon appliances ( White Goods) • $20.00 for all other appliances (White Goods) • $30.00 per item for all Bulky Goods ( Bulky Goods) – Couch, Over stuff chair, Love seat, Mattress, Rugs, Kitchen Set, etc. • $30.00 for all TV’s & CRT Monitors Payment: Credit Card or check payable to Pinard Waste Systems

HOLIDAY SCHEDULE
Collections will be postponed by one day if your trash is picked up on or after the following holidays: • Independence Day Wednesday 7/4/07 • Labor Day Monday 9/3/07 • Thanksgiving Day Thursday 11/22/07 • Christmas Day Tuesday 12/25/07 • New Year’s Tuesday 1/1/08 • Memorial Day Monday 5/26/08 For example, if a holiday occurs on a Monday, that day’s trash routes will be picked up on Tuesday, Tuesday’s trash on Wednesday, and so forth.

RESIDENTIAL REMINDERS ON TRASH AND RECYCLING COLLECTION
• Recycling & Trash should be curbside on your collection day by 7:00am. • Keep recycling bins and barrels 5 feet from Automated Collection carts. • Use paper bags when shopping. Plastic bags can’t be recycled. • Cardboard should be flattened and no bigger than 2’ ft. wide & 3’ ft long. • Please keep all plastic water/soda bottles, plastic milk jugs, laundry detergent jugs, tin cans, aluminum cans and glass bottles in the same recycling bin or barrel.
